In recent years, entertainment "reality" TV everywhere in China, setting off a a wave of ratings, each big TV have to spend lots of money making his own brand of variety. In the meantime, the TV not only continue to introduce foreign copyright, and cooperation programmes also emerge in an endless stream and get some success. Therefore, the continuous deepening of communication with South Korea in the television industry has become a universal and special phenomenon in our country. The biggest feature of reality show is true, but there is no "show" as the premise, and then it may not cause the audience’s interest. Therefore, through the analysis and comparison to study the narrative mode of China and South Korea reality show, we can draw the narrative mode is not only an important way to the reality show on the road to success, but also enrich the narrative of the scope of application, so also it’s a new viewpoint on the orders of the day. In this paper, we from the narrative point of view of "reality shows" launched detail, trying to sum up the narrative features of the program and the narrative mode, in the hope of providing some reference value of our country "reality show" development.
